OEM Hydraulic Pump
An OEM hydraulic pump comes from the company that made your machine. Volvo makes these pumps for their own excavators. OEM pumps use strong materials and follow strict rules. They are made to fit your volvo excavator exactly. These pumps go through hard tests to make sure they last. You can trust them to work well every day. OEM pumps can be gear, piston, or vane type. Gear pumps are simple and good for heavy jobs. Piston pumps handle high pressure and can change flow. Vane pumps are not used much now but are found in older machines.

Rebuilt Hydraulic Pump
A rebuilt volvo excavator hydraulic pump starts as a used pump. Experts take it apart and look at every piece. They make a plan to fix it. Worn parts get replaced or fixed. Then, they put the pump back together. After that, they test it for leaks and how well it works. Rebuilt pumps can help you save money and keep your excavator working. The quality depends on how well the pump is rebuilt. You need to make sure the rebuilt pump fits your machine and meets Volvo’s rules. Rebuilt pumps are often gear or piston type, just like OEM and aftermarket pumps.

Cause of Failure | Description |
---|---|
Wear and Tear | The hydraulic pump wears out over time from use. |
Leaks | Leaks can lower performance and cause pressure drops. |
Banging and Knocking Sounds | Air in the system can cause noise and overheating. |
Increase in Temperature | A bad pump can get too hot, hurting seals and fluid. |
Weak Final Drive Motor | Low hydraulic fluid pressure can make the final drive motor weak. |
Improper Maintenance Practices | Skipping maintenance can lower efficiency and cause failure. |
Inadequate Cleaning | Not cleaning parts can let dirt in, causing blockages and more wear. |
Contamination of Hydraulic Fluid | Dirty fluid can cause rust and wear on pump parts. |
Misuse of Equipment | Using the machine too hard can damage the hydraulic system. |
Extreme Working Conditions | Hot and dusty places can hurt fluid and make parts wear faster. |
Mechanical Wear and Tear | Using the pump a lot wears out inside parts and lowers efficiency. |

Initial Price
When you check the price of a volvo excavator hydraulic pump, you will see big differences. OEM pumps cost the most because they come from volvo. They fit well and work best. Aftermarket pumps cost less and give you more options. Rebuilt pumps are usually the cheapest, but their quality depends on how well they were fixed.
Here are some usual prices for aftermarket hydraulic pumps for volvo excavators:
$3,150.00 to $13,790.00 for most models
$5,131.00 for a pump for the EC360 model
$6,790.00 for a pump for the EC460 model
From $3,850.00 for a pump for the EC135B LC model
